The objective of this study is to show that the use of electrodialyzed seawater reduces the duration (in days) of symptoms in acute infant bronchiolitis compared with the use of saline solution in infants aged 1 month to less than one year.
B-CLASS study is a multicenter, prospective, controlled, randomized, double label blind.
